The International Cricket Council (ICC) is considering expanding the T20 World Cup to include 32 teams by the year 2028, a significant increase from the current format featuring 20 participating nations. This potential change was discussed during the ICC's Annual General Meeting held in Singapore. The next edition of the tournament, scheduled for 2026, will be co-hosted by India and Sri Lanka and is anticipated to take place between February and March.

32 teams in T20 World Cup 2028?

Further details emerging from the ICC AGM, as reported by Forbes, indicate that the proposal to enlarge the T20 World Cup to a 32-team event is under serious consideration. A dedicated six-person group, spearheaded by an official from New Zealand Cricket, will be responsible for determining the selection process and inclusion of these additional teams in the 2028 edition.

“An expanded 32-team T20 World Cup has been mooted as a working group looks into cricket’s formats and major competitions. The six-man working group will be led by New Zealand’s Roger Twose and comprise bosses from the power nations India, Australia and England,” the Forbes report stated.

This discussion about expanding the tournament follows Italy's historic qualification for the T20 World Cup in 2026, marking their debut in the event. Italy, along with the Netherlands, successfully secured their spots in the prestigious tournament through the Europe Qualifier.

The recently concluded AGM addressed several significant matters, with final decisions being reached on Sunday.

Among the key topics discussed was the qualification process for the Los Angeles Olympics. It was proposed that regional rankings would largely determine the participating teams in the men's competition, scheduled to take place from July 12th to 29th in Pomona, located 30 miles east of Los Angeles. According to the proposal, the highest-ranked teams from Asia, Oceania, Europe, and Africa would secure automatic qualification. In addition to these regional qualifiers, the host nation, the United States, would also automatically qualify, representing the Americas.

Teams who have qualified for T20 World Cup 2026

So far a total of 15 teams have qualified for the T20 World Cup 2026 including the hosts India and Sri Lanka.

Here is the list:
India, Sri Lanka, Afghanistan, Australia, Bangladesh, England, South Africa, United States, West Indies, Ireland, New Zealand, Pakistan, Canada, Italy, Netherlands
